Because we are old enough to remember what it was like before Obamacare.

That's the thing you kids forget: the situation was dire before the ACA. Everyone knew it. ACA is just a national version of Romney-care. A Republican Presidential candidate was the first guy in the country to pass this kind of legislation.

But Republicans were vehemently against Obama and spent 8 years fighting everything he did. Even when he introduced their own fucking idea. They have done their best to make it work as terribly as possible so they can call it a failure... And the people stilll overwhelmingly agree it's better than what we had before.

The solution to the ACA isn't to take money out of the system. It's to add money.

What needs to happen to actually reign in costs is quite a few things:

1. The garbage Bush legislation that prevents the government from negotiating for lower pharmaceutical prices needs to be repealed.

2. There needs to be a cap placed on end-of-life treatments, which are the majority of the U.S. healthcare expenditures. If the procedure will not lead to a significant improvement in either longevity or quality of life, doctors need to be required to refuse them. You can use fear mongering language like "death panels" if you want, but this is essential.

3. Malpractice litigation needs to be reformed. The Democrats have bogged down the system nonsense red tape that results in doctors ordering far more tests and recommending unnecessary procedures just to cover their asses and stave off malpractice lawsuits.

4. There needs to be a major PR campaign launched educating people about the difference between urgent care clinics and emergency rooms, and when to use one instead of the other.
